系統(tǒng)代理與TUN設(shè)備的配置與應(yīng)用指南
1.1 系統(tǒng)代理的概念和作用
在現(xiàn)在的網(wǎng)絡(luò)世界中,系統(tǒng)代理充當(dāng)了一個(gè)橋梁,讓我們可以更好地管理和訪問(wèn)網(wǎng)絡(luò)。簡(jiǎn)單來(lái)說(shuō),系統(tǒng)代理是一種網(wǎng)絡(luò)服務(wù),它可以在我們和互聯(lián)網(wǎng)之間傳遞信息。通過(guò)使用代理,用戶能夠隱藏自己的真實(shí)IP地址、繞過(guò)地理限制,甚至保護(hù)自己的在線隱私。想象一下,當(dāng)你在咖啡館或者機(jī)場(chǎng)使用公共Wi-Fi時(shí),代理就像一道保護(hù)罩,幫你過(guò)濾掉潛在的危險(xiǎn),讓你安全上網(wǎng)。
對(duì)很多人來(lái)說(shuō),系統(tǒng)代理的最顯著作用之一是提高訪問(wèn)特定網(wǎng)站或服務(wù)的速度和穩(wěn)定性。有些地區(qū)由于網(wǎng)絡(luò)限制,常常無(wú)法訪問(wèn)某些國(guó)外網(wǎng)站。通過(guò)合適的代理設(shè)置,我們可以順利訪問(wèn)這些網(wǎng)站。除此之外,企業(yè)常常將代理用作監(jiān)控和限制員工的網(wǎng)絡(luò)訪問(wèn),甚至用于緩存常用的網(wǎng)頁(yè),以提升訪問(wèn)速度。
1.2 如何在不同操作系統(tǒng)中配置系統(tǒng)代理
不同的操作系統(tǒng)有各自的方法來(lái)配置系統(tǒng)代理。雖然步驟可能略有不同,但原理基本一致,我會(huì)逐一為你介紹。
1.2.1 Windows系統(tǒng)的代理設(shè)置步驟
在Windows系統(tǒng)中,設(shè)置代理并不復(fù)雜。首先,打開(kāi)“設(shè)置”,然后找到“網(wǎng)絡(luò)和互聯(lián)網(wǎng)”選項(xiàng)。接著,點(diǎn)擊左側(cè)的“代理”選項(xiàng)。在這里你會(huì)看到手動(dòng)代理設(shè)置的選項(xiàng),開(kāi)啟它,填寫(xiě)代理服務(wù)器的地址和端口號(hào),最后保存設(shè)置。一旦完成,你的所有網(wǎng)絡(luò)流量都會(huì)通過(guò)新的代理進(jìn)行傳輸。
有時(shí)候,我會(huì)遇到需要關(guān)閉代理的情況。在同一頁(yè)面,只需將“使用代理服務(wù)器”選項(xiàng)關(guān)閉,網(wǎng)絡(luò)就會(huì)恢復(fù)到正常狀態(tài)。在這一過(guò)程中,不同版本的Windows可能會(huì)有些細(xì)微的不同,但整體步驟是相似的。
1.2.2 macOS系統(tǒng)的代理設(shè)置步驟
接下來(lái)是macOS系統(tǒng)的代理設(shè)置。在我的Mac上,我通常打開(kāi)“系統(tǒng)偏好設(shè)置”,然后選擇“網(wǎng)絡(luò)”。選擇所連接的網(wǎng)絡(luò),比如Wi-Fi,點(diǎn)擊“高級(jí)”,再選擇“代理”。這里會(huì)出現(xiàn)多個(gè)代理設(shè)置選項(xiàng),比如HTTP、HTTPS和SOCKS。如果我只需要設(shè)置HTTP代理,我只需勾選該選項(xiàng)并輸入代理地址和端口號(hào),最后點(diǎn)擊“好”即可。
值得注意的是,每次更改代理設(shè)置后,我總是記得需要重新啟動(dòng)瀏覽器,以確保新的設(shè)置生效。這小小的步驟可以避免不少麻煩。
1.2.3 Linux系統(tǒng)的代理設(shè)置步驟
如果你使用的是Linux,設(shè)置代理可能需要一些命令行操作。通常,我會(huì)打開(kāi)終端,使用export
命令來(lái)設(shè)置環(huán)境變量。例如,輸入export http_proxy=http://your_proxy_address:port
。此外,使用unset
命令也可以很容易地取消代理設(shè)置,非常方便。
在許多Linux發(fā)行版中,圖形界面的設(shè)置方法也在逐漸變得流行。我推薦查看系統(tǒng)設(shè)置中的網(wǎng)絡(luò)部分,一般都能找到代理設(shè)置選項(xiàng)。這使得配置變得更直觀,尤其適合初學(xué)者。
1.3 常見(jiàn)問(wèn)題與解決方案
在使用系統(tǒng)代理的過(guò)程中,難免會(huì)遇到一些問(wèn)題。了解這些常見(jiàn)問(wèn)題及其解決方案非常重要。
1.3.1 代理連接失敗的排查
如果出現(xiàn)代理連接失敗的情況,我會(huì)首先確認(rèn)輸入的代理地址和端口是否正確。接著,檢查網(wǎng)絡(luò)連接是否正常。有時(shí),代理服務(wù)器本身可能出現(xiàn)問(wèn)題,這個(gè)時(shí)候可以嘗試更換代理,看看是否能恢復(fù)連接。
另外,檢查防火墻設(shè)置也很重要,有時(shí)候防火墻會(huì)攔截代理請(qǐng)求,導(dǎo)致無(wú)法連接。在這種情況下,適當(dāng)調(diào)整防火墻規(guī)則可以幫助解決問(wèn)題。
1.3.2 如何優(yōu)化代理設(shè)置以提高網(wǎng)絡(luò)速度
想要提高通過(guò)代理訪問(wèn)網(wǎng)絡(luò)的速度,有幾個(gè)方法我常用。首先,選擇一個(gè)速度更快的代理服務(wù)器是最直接的方法。市面上有許多代理服務(wù)提供商可以選擇,某些高質(zhì)量的代理能夠提供更快的速度和更少的延遲。
此外,使用HTTP/2協(xié)議的代理也能大幅提高速度。這個(gè)協(xié)議在數(shù)據(jù)傳輸上更高效,因此我總會(huì)傾向于選擇支持該協(xié)議的代理配置。通過(guò)這些小技巧,我們可以使網(wǎng)絡(luò)體驗(yàn)更加流暢和高效。
2.1 TUN設(shè)備的定義與工作原理
在網(wǎng)絡(luò)技術(shù)中,TUN設(shè)備是一種虛擬網(wǎng)絡(luò)接口,它能夠?qū)⒕W(wǎng)絡(luò)數(shù)據(jù)包直接從用戶空間傳送到內(nèi)核空間。這種設(shè)備通常用于實(shí)現(xiàn)VPN(虛擬私人網(wǎng)絡(luò))或其他類型的隧道連接。當(dāng)我在使用TUN設(shè)備時(shí),可以想象自己在創(chuàng)建一條虛擬的隧道,數(shù)據(jù)通過(guò)這條隧道以加密的形式傳輸,從而保護(hù)我的隱私和安全。
TUN設(shè)備工作在網(wǎng)絡(luò)層,它只處理IP數(shù)據(jù)包。在傳輸過(guò)程中,數(shù)據(jù)包的來(lái)源和去向可以被有效地控制和調(diào)整。利用TUN設(shè)備,可以靈活地實(shí)現(xiàn)如IP路由、網(wǎng)絡(luò)分隔等功能,使得網(wǎng)絡(luò)環(huán)境更加安全和可靠。對(duì)于我來(lái)說(shuō),這不僅意味著能夠更安全地使用互聯(lián)網(wǎng),還能在需要時(shí)輕松構(gòu)建自己的網(wǎng)絡(luò)環(huán)境。
2.2 如何創(chuàng)建和配置TUN設(shè)備
創(chuàng)建和配置TUN設(shè)備的步驟在幾個(gè)操作系統(tǒng)中是略有不同的。我通常會(huì)在Linux系統(tǒng)上進(jìn)行配置,因?yàn)檫@個(gè)系統(tǒng)提供了更多的控制選項(xiàng)和靈活性。
2.2.1 在Linux系統(tǒng)中創(chuàng)建TUN設(shè)備的步驟
在Linux中創(chuàng)建TUN設(shè)備相對(duì)簡(jiǎn)單。首先,我需要確保系統(tǒng)已安裝tun模塊。可以通過(guò)命令lsmod | grep tun
來(lái)檢查。如果沒(méi)有安裝,我會(huì)使用命令modprobe tun
來(lái)加載它。
隨后,可以使用命令行工具如“ip”來(lái)創(chuàng)建TUN設(shè)備。舉個(gè)例子,輸入ip tuntap add dev tun0 mode tun
可以創(chuàng)建一個(gè)名為tun0的新設(shè)備。接下來(lái),我需要啟用這個(gè)設(shè)備,使用命令ip link set dev tun0 up
。通過(guò)ip addr add
命令,可以為T(mén)UN設(shè)備分配一個(gè)IP地址。完成這些步驟后,就可以通過(guò)該TUN設(shè)備發(fā)送和接收數(shù)據(jù),使得網(wǎng)絡(luò)通信變得更加安全。
2.2.2 TUN與Tap設(shè)備的比較
在TUN和Tap設(shè)備之間選擇時(shí),我會(huì)考慮我的具體需求。TUN屬于網(wǎng)絡(luò)層,它處理IP數(shù)據(jù)包。因此,適用于需要IP層協(xié)議的場(chǎng)景,比如VPN。而Tap設(shè)備則屬于數(shù)據(jù)鏈路層,它處理以太網(wǎng)幀,適合對(duì)網(wǎng)絡(luò)層面有更復(fù)雜需求的應(yīng)用,比如虛擬機(jī)的網(wǎng)絡(luò)通信。
總的來(lái)說(shuō),如果只是需要設(shè)置簡(jiǎn)單的VPN連接,TUN設(shè)備是個(gè)不錯(cuò)的選擇。如果涉及更復(fù)雜的網(wǎng)絡(luò)環(huán)境,Tap設(shè)備則是更理想的選擇。根據(jù)需求選擇合適的設(shè)備,能夠在大大提高網(wǎng)絡(luò)效率的同時(shí),簡(jiǎn)化配置過(guò)程。
2.3 TUN設(shè)備在網(wǎng)絡(luò)中的應(yīng)用場(chǎng)景
TUN設(shè)備因其獨(dú)特的優(yōu)勢(shì),在許多場(chǎng)景中得到了廣泛應(yīng)用。作為個(gè)人用戶,我感受到它在VPN和流量加密方面的顯著效果。
2.3.1 VPN和隧道的實(shí)現(xiàn)
使用TUN設(shè)備,我能夠輕松創(chuàng)建VPN,讓我的網(wǎng)絡(luò)流量通過(guò)安全的隧道傳輸。這種隱私保護(hù)機(jī)制能夠隱藏我的IP地址,從而避免被追蹤或監(jiān)控。在我外出時(shí),通過(guò)公共Wi-Fi上網(wǎng),我總是會(huì)感覺(jué)更安心,因?yàn)閿?shù)據(jù)已經(jīng)被加密,保護(hù)了我的信息安全。
此外,TUN設(shè)備還非常適合在跨國(guó)訪問(wèn)受限制網(wǎng)站的場(chǎng)景中應(yīng)用。通過(guò)將流量路由到境外的服務(wù)器,我能夠順暢訪問(wèn)被封鎖的內(nèi)容,享受更自由的上網(wǎng)體驗(yàn)。
2.3.2 在網(wǎng)絡(luò)性能測(cè)試中的使用
除了VPN,TUN設(shè)備在網(wǎng)絡(luò)性能測(cè)試中的表現(xiàn)也很出色。在進(jìn)行網(wǎng)絡(luò)測(cè)速時(shí),我可以通過(guò)TUN設(shè)備模擬不同的網(wǎng)絡(luò)條件,測(cè)試各種流量負(fù)載下的性能。這種靈活性使得我能夠獲得準(zhǔn)確的網(wǎng)絡(luò)表現(xiàn)數(shù)據(jù),幫助我進(jìn)行優(yōu)化和調(diào)整。
通過(guò)多種配置和調(diào)試,我能夠找到網(wǎng)絡(luò)中可能存在的瓶頸,進(jìn)而提升整體性能。正因如此,TUN設(shè)備在專業(yè)領(lǐng)域也越來(lái)越普遍,成為網(wǎng)絡(luò)工程師和測(cè)試人員的重要工具。
2.4 安全性考慮與常見(jiàn)問(wèn)題解決
在使用TUN設(shè)備時(shí),安全性是我非常關(guān)注的問(wèn)題。在配置和使用過(guò)程中,了解相關(guān)的風(fēng)險(xiǎn)和解決方案能夠幫助我避免潛在的麻煩。
2.4.1 TUN設(shè)置中常見(jiàn)的安全風(fēng)險(xiǎn)
盡管TUN設(shè)備可以提高清晰度,但不當(dāng)配置可能會(huì)帶來(lái)安全隱患。例如,若沒(méi)有妥善配置防火墻規(guī)則,惡意攻擊者可能會(huì)趁機(jī)接觸我的數(shù)據(jù)。因此,我通常會(huì)確保在使用TUN設(shè)備時(shí),配置有效的防火墻策略,限制不必要的流量進(jìn)入我的網(wǎng)絡(luò)。
另外,保持TUN設(shè)備的相關(guān)軟件和系統(tǒng)更新也是非常重要的,這能夠修補(bǔ)漏洞,進(jìn)一步增強(qiáng)安全性。
2.4.2 如何防止數(shù)據(jù)泄露與流量監(jiān)控
為了防止數(shù)據(jù)泄露和流量監(jiān)控,我會(huì)選擇具有良好加密技術(shù)的VPN服務(wù),確保數(shù)據(jù)在傳輸過(guò)程中不被第三方輕易竊取。使用更強(qiáng)的加密協(xié)議,如OpenVPN或WireGuard,可以有效保障我的網(wǎng)絡(luò)安全。
同時(shí),定期檢查和審計(jì)網(wǎng)絡(luò)流量可以讓我及時(shí)發(fā)現(xiàn)異常活動(dòng),從而采取行動(dòng)保護(hù)我的隱私和數(shù)據(jù)安全。實(shí)施這些措施,使得我在使用TUN設(shè)備時(shí)更為放心和安心。
掃描二維碼推送至手機(jī)訪問(wèn)。
版權(quán)聲明:本文由皇冠云發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。